Project American History on Immigration
Part 1.
You will choose a country from the list that the teacher will provide. You will do some research on this country answering the following question. (Note Taking Skills)
1. Why did the people immigrate to America?
2. How did they travel to America? What happened during the travel period? How long did it take?
3. When they finally arrived in America, what did they do? Where did they go?
This part of the project is due Tuesday of week 3. You will share and discuss what you found with the class.
Part 2.
You will create a documentary on immigration from your chosen country to America. You will create a narrative including the information from part 1. Remember a narrative must be descriptive. You are painting a picture in our minds as to what you went through when you immigrated. You must have visuals to along with your narrative. You can do this using prezi or power point. You may use old images from the past about your country. Please be creative. I will have several things that I will grade'on ( the narrative, the information provided and creativity ). This project will be presented starting Tuesday of Week
4. Do not wait until the last minute to put this together. Working on this a little bit everyday will give you a much better project.
